    I am running Vista. I had two, actually three problems. First was that for some reason, my CD/DVD drive disappeared. I found that the solution to this was to delete the LowerFilters and UpperFilters strings in the registry. That worked and I got my CD drive back. However, I then got that pesky error message from iTunes. That was the second problem. The third problem was that I could no longer burn CD's of my playlists from iTunes and it said that the "disc burner or software was missing." Going online, I discovered that I was not the only one experiencing these three problems.
    I happened to find the solution about the Gear drivers at http://www.pcdoctor-guide.com/wordpress/?p=2726. Installing the x32_x64 driver, of course, worked for me since I'm running a PC laptop. This took care of all three problems for me.
    If you notice, the other post about editing the registry makes reference to the Gear ASPI driver. Gear is the one (as you would read on the first link) that provides the drivers for software to burn CD's.
